The Game Claims He Put On 'Your Favorite West Coast Artists'

The Game feels he doesn't get the respect he deserves when it comes to helping West Coast artists, but says Dr. Dre and Top Dawg know the real deal.

The Game doesnt think he gets the respect he deserves for supporting West Coast artists during the early stages of their careers. Taking to Twitter on Sunday night (October 24), the Compton rapper said refusing to be a puppet is the reason he hasnt received recognition over the past 18 years, while noting his mentor Dr. Dreand TDE founder Anthony Top Dawg Tiffithknow just how much hes done. I never got my flowers from the industry cause wouldnt be a puppet for the dollar bill #ThugLife, The Game wrote. You know how many of your favorite WEST COAST artists I hand a hand in puttin on ??? Just being a good n-gga. Was offered finders fees, couldve signed n-ggas.. etc, I just wanted to see n-ggas from my side win. He added, Ask Dr. Dre. Ask Top Dawg, ask n-ggas I been solid for n-ggas since 2003 in this shit. The definition of GOOD LOOKIN.'
